Water features are a quintessential component in crafting an acoustic garden. The gentle murmur of a stream or the rhythmic drip of a water cascade can drown out undesirable noises while promoting tranquility. Consider a strategically placed fountain or a cascading waterfall to serve as the centerpiece of your soundscape. These elements can transform an ordinary garden into an oasis of calm, facilitating a deeper connection with nature.

The role of plants in a soundscape cannot be overstated. Different plants not only add visual interest but also contribute to the auditory tapestry. Ornamental grasses like Miscanthus and Bamboo rustle gently in the breeze, creating a soft, whispering effect that is both soothing and rhythmic. Planting a variety of trees can also invite local birds, whose morning calls add a delightful chorus to your outdoor symphony.

Strategically placed hedges and shrubs can play a significant role in sound reflection and absorption, effectively enhancing the clarity of your garden's music. They act as natural sound barriers that help manage noise pollution, allowing you to enjoy the serenity of your outdoor space without disturbance.

Incorporating seating areas is a vital aspect of soundscape design. These are not just places to sit, but focal points where you can fully immerse yourself in the harmonious sounds around you. Consider placing a bench near a water feature or under a canopy of trees to provide a peaceful retreat where you can indulge in the calming effects of your personalized garden orchestra.

Wind chimes are another excellent addition to a soundscape, offering a touch of whimsy and auditory beauty. Their gentle chiming can be an occasional pleasant surprise, adding layers to your garden's acoustic symphony. Choose materials and designs that complement your overall garden aesthetic while enhancing the natural sounds.
